This is a delicious curry dip, add as much curry as you desire. If you don’t have spreadable cream cheese you can just use a normal block of cream cheese – just let it sit out until it is room temperature so it easier to mix.
PrintCurry Dip
- Prep Time: 5 mins
- Total Time: 5 mins
- Yield: serves 6
- Category: Dip
Ingredients
Scale
- 250g spreadable cream cheese
- 1/3 cup mayonnaise
- 2 teaspoons curry powder (to taste)
- 1 tablespoons sweet chilli sauce
- 3 tablespoons lemon juice
- 1 teaspoon
worcestershire sauce - 3 spring onions, thinly sliced
Instructions
- Mix cream cheese, mayo and curry powder together until well combined.
- Add sweet chilli sauce, lemon juice,
worcestershire sauce and spring onion, stir well. - Cover and refrigerate until required.
